2 Investment basics All investment carries an element of risk. Successful investment involves balancing the different kinds of risk. There are three main kinds of investment risk: Account movement This is the risk that the value of your investments may go down in value. Investments which carry this risk such as equities (shares) have tended in the past to provide a good level of investment growth over the longer term. Because of this, you may be prepared to accept this risk over a large part of your working life in order to aim for higher investment returns. Pension adequacy This is the risk that your investments may not grow faster than inflation over the long term. Investments which carry this risk, such as cash, tend to be secure in the short term. However over the long term, inflation can eat away at their value and you risk not being able to secure an adequate benefit. Because of this, cash tends to be used as a short-term investment only. Pension movement This is the risk that a sudden increase in the cost of buying pensions just before you retire could take away some of the buying power of your account. Investments such as bonds (loans to a company or the Government) can help to safeguard your account against this risk as the value of bonds tends to move in line with the cost of buying pensions. Your investment approaches There are two approaches that you can take: ``Option 1: you can choose Lifestyle. This approach invests your contributions in a set mix of investment funds and automatically switches your account into progressively less risky investments as you approach retirement. Lifestyle is designed to manage risk from pension movement. ``Option 2: you can choose individual investment funds and the proportion of your account you would like to invest in each of these funds. Alternatively, you can allocate some of your investments to option 1 and the rest to option 2. We recommend that you take independent financial advice before selecting your investment approach. Option 1: Choosing Lifestyle With Lifestyle, the contributions to your account are automatically invested in a mixture of funds that vary according to the number of years to your normal retirement age. Lifestyle aims to take advantage of the way different investments behave, and to balance different types of investment risk. [2] I NVESTMENT OPTIONS FOSTER WHEELER PENSION PLAN

3 In the early to middle part of your career Lifestyle invests mainly in equities (shares). Equities are generally expected to give higher investment returns in the long term, helping to guard against pension adequacy risk, though they can lose value quickly in the short term (account movement risk). As you approach retirement, your account is gradually switched into bonds and cash, to take advantage of their greater expected stability and guard against pension movement risk. If you choose the Lifestyle option, your pension account will be invested initially in the Aquila (50:50) Global Equity Index Fund (85%) and the Aquila Over 15 year Corporate Bond Fund (15%). When you are six years away from your normal retirement age, your account will start to be gradually transferred from the BlackRock Global Equity Fund into the Aquila Over 15 year Gilt Index Fund. Approximately two years later, another part of your account in the BlackRock Global Equity Fund will also start to be transferred into the Cash Fund. When you are two years away from your normal retirement age, the part of your account held within the BlackRock Corporate Bond Fund will begin to be transferred into the BlackRock Gilt and Cash Funds. By the time you reach one year from your normal retirement age, approximately 75% of your account will be invested in the BlackRock DC Aquila Over 15 year Gilt Index Fund and 25% in the Cash Fund as illustrated in the chart. Ongoing contributions will be paid into the relevant Lifestyle funds, depending on your time horizon to your retirement age. 4 The Lifestyle option will not necessarily produce higher benefits than other approaches to investment. Future stock market conditions may mean that for some periods of time, equities do not give better returns than other types of investment. The Lifestyle option is designed to produce a sensible mix of investment returns and risks for the majority of members. It may not be appropriate for everyone. The Trustees may change the Lifestyle option and the funds in it in the future. Important changing your DC retirement age The normal retirement age for Foster Wheeler employees is 65. However, you may nominate a target DC retirement age between 55 75, as currently stipulated by the UK government. This does not necessarily have to be the same age as your retirement from employment. If you want to draw your DC pension at any age other than 65, you will need to tell the administrators as soon as you decide, as your account will need to be switched to match your target DC retirement age. 5 Passively managed funds Passively managed means that the investment manager aims to follow or track the returns of a market index (which is why this approach is also known as index tracking ). This approach does not aim to achieve higher returns than the market index. It does aim to minimise the risk of achieving lower returns than the market index. You should remember that the market index can go down as well as up. Actively managed funds Actively managed means that the investment manager aims to achieve higher returns than the market index over the long term. Actively managed funds carry a slightly higher risk than passively managed funds as the returns could be lower than the market index. Funds available Thirteen investment funds are currently available. You can choose to invest in one or more of these funds. The capital risk indicates the degree of risk associated with each fund, with 7 representing the highest risk and 1 the lowest risk. Capital risk is the risk of your pension savings falling in value. What does this mean for you and your pension account? The range of investment options caters for different attitudes to risk and the requirement to balance risk with reward according to an individual s needs and goals. The funds invest in a wide range of asset classes (types of investment), which carry different levels of risk, including: cash, bonds and equities (company shares). Dealing with the main types of investment in order of risk: ``Cash is the safest but is likely to generate comparatively lower investment returns over the long term; historically cash savings have struggled to beat inflation. ``Fixed Income Funds invest in a spread of fixed income investments, including government bonds and perhaps corporate bonds, and are suitable for lower risk investors, particularly where individuals may be looking to buy an annuity. ``Multi-Asset Funds invest in a mix of UK and global equities, Fixed Income funds, cash and alternative investments such as commercial property and commodities. Given the diversity in assets, a Multi-Asset Fund offers more fund stability than a fund of pure equities but, as a result, may reduce the potential for higher rate returns. ``Property Funds invest in UK commercial property assets such as offices, shopping centres, retail warehouse parks and industrial estates, and are suitable for medium risk investors looking for long-term growth. ` ` Equity Funds are invested in shares of companies, which can be based in the UK or overseas. There is greater volatility than the other funds described above, but improved long-term growth prospects. INVESTMENT OPTIONS FOSTER WHEELER PENSION PLAN [ 5 ]

6 Risk rating: We have classified each fund option with a risk rating from 1 to 7 in the fund table. 1 (Very Low), 2 (Low), 3 (Low-Medium), 4 (Medium), 5 (Medium-High), 6 (High), 7 (Very High). Remember that the higher the risk score, the greater the potential for good long-term growth. However, the higher risk funds are also likely to display greater volatility over the shorter term. Alternatively you can send an to dchelpdesk.europe@blackrock.com Fund investment charges The annual management charges imposed by the investment manager depend on which funds you invest in. They are included in the table on the next page. The management charge for the Lifestyle option is calculated from the charges for the funds it uses. For example, if your pension account was valued at 10,000 and was invested in the Global Equity Fund, the annual management charge deducted from your pension account would be 15 ( 10,000 x 0.15%). If your account was invested in the Lifestyle option, your pension account was valued at 10,000 and was invested 85% in the Global Equity Fund and 15% in the Corporate Bond Fund, the annual management charge deducted from your pension account would be 15 ( 8,500 x 0.15% + 1,500 x 0.15%). 7 Changing your choices From time to time, you should review your investment choices to ensure that they continue to meet your needs, and make changes if necessary. There are two changes you can make: ``You can re-direct future contributions to a different investment fund (or funds) And/or ``You can switch your accumulated pension account to a different investment fund (or funds). You may make two switches of funds per calendar year free of charge. Further switches may incur a charge of 25 each at the Trustees discretion. Both redirection of future contribution and switching existing funds can be done by completing the appropriate section(s) on the investment fund choice form available on the pension pages of the intranet. Alternatively, these changes may be made online via Towers Watson s epa facility. Investment charges* Risk rating * The Investment Charges include the Total Expense Ratio ( TER ). The TER of a fund is the ratio of the fund s total operating costs to its average net assets and is an indication of the total cost to an investor of investing in a fund. The TER includes the annual management charge (AMC) and any other costs that might be borne by the fund. Examples might include dealing and audit costs.
